Stephen Tuttle Arnot, 1829 - 1884 Stephen Tuttle Arnot 1829 1884 New York New York
Stephen Tuttle Arnot was born in 1829, in , New York, to John Arnot and Harriet Arnot (born Tuttle).
Stephen had 5 siblings: Mariana Tuttle Ogden (born Arnot), Aurelia Covell Arnot and .
Stephen married M. Charlotte Arnot (born Hewitt).
Stephen passed away on 1884, at age 55 in , New York.
